skaalautuvuusongelmat
Skaalautuvuusongelmat ovat järjestelmän kyvyttömyyttä skaalata käsittelemään suurempaa kuormitusta tai suurempia käyttäjämääriä ilman merkittävää suorituskyvyn heikkenemistä. Skaalautuvuus voidaan saavuttaa sekä pystysuorilla (scale up) että vaakasuuntaisilla (scale out) ratkaisuilla, kuten lisäresurssien hankkimisella tai kuorman jakamisella useammalle solulle.
Suurimmat syyt skaalaantumisen ongelmiin ovat pullonkaulat, kilpailu ja lukitukset, I/O- ja verkko-viiveet sekä tiedon koordinointi. Datan
Skaalautuvuus voidaan jakaa useisiin tyyppeihin. Suorituskyvyn skaalautuvuus kuvaa, miten läpäisy ja vasteaika kehittyvät kuorman kasvaessa. Dataskaalautuvuus
Ratkaisukeinoja ovat tilattomuus (stateless) arkkitehtuuri, kuorman tasaus, hajautettu tallennus ja sharding, caching, asynkroninen viestintä, back-pressure sekä
Mittarit: läpäisy (requests per sekunti), vasteaika (latenssi), P95/P99, resurssien käyttö, virheet sekä kustannus- ja suorituskykytunnusluvut. Skaalautuvuus